Consider recommendations regarding Regional Fire Communications Center Partner Cooperative Dispatch Agreements, as follows:
a) Approve and authorize the Fire Chief to execute Cooperative Dispatch Agreements with partner fire agencies, the City of Lompoc and City of Guadalupe;
b) Approve and authorize the Chair to execute a Second Amendment to the Cooperative Dispatch Agreements with partner fire agencies, the Carpinteria-Summerland Fire Protection District, Montecito Fire Protection District, City of Santa Barbara, City of Santa Maria, City of Lompoc, and City of Guadalupe;
c) Approve and authorize the Fire Chief, or designee, subject to the Board’s ability to rescind this delegated authority at any time, to make immaterial changes, subject to concurrence by the Office of the Auditor-Controller, to the agreement; and
d) Find that the above actions are not a project under the California Environmental Quality Act (CEQA) pursuant to CEQA Guidelines Section 15378(b)(2) in that they involve continuing administrative or maintenance activities, and CEQA Guidelines Section 15378(b)(5), in that they involve organizational or administrative activities of government that will not result in direct or indirect physical changes in the environment.
